How to book on a course

• Click on the name of the course you would like to attend (this will take you straight into eProg – you will be prompted for your University username and password on first login)

• In the content tab, under ‘Events’ are a list of available dates. Click ‘Apply’ then select the date of the training you wish to attend

• If places are available, you will receive an onscreen confirmation reserving your place on the course

• All the training you have attended will be recorded in eProg

The Skills Audit

Page 14: eResources Induction

What is the Skills Audit?

A set of questions which ask you about your skills and expertise in six areas

A way for you to discover where your current skill strengths lie and find out the areas you need to develop

Page 15: eResources Induction

What are the six question areas?

• Bibliographic and computer skills• Communication Skills• Personal Effectiveness• Research Design and Techniques• Research Environment Skills• Career Management Skills

Page 16: eResources Induction

How does it work?

Each question asks you to rate your level of expertise from basic through to expert

Your answers will build up a picture of where your strengths and areas of development are

Page 17: eResources Induction

What happens after I complete the audit?

Click on ‘Summary of your skills’ to review your answers• In which areas do your strengths lie? • Which areas do you need to develop?

Review your answers then look for suitable courses on the training calendar that might help with your development
